Alien: Earth star Samuel Blenkin explains how the brand new company within the TV collection is completely different from the pre-established Weyland-Yutani. The upcoming Alien: Earth will see area vessel Maginot crashing into the planet, bringing with it Xenomorphs and different threatening extraterrestrial species. Centered all through would be the Prodigy Company, an organization targeted on synthetic-human hybrid tech whereas investigating the crash.

Throughout an interview with ScreenRant‘s Liam Crowley for Alien: Earth, Samuel Blenkin, who performs Prodigy Company CEO Boy Kavalier, unpacked how the brand new firm is completely different from Weyland-Yutani. He defined how Boy’s imaginative and prescient is fast-moving, embracing hybrid know-how that might permit folks to maneuver past their physicality, asking questions on what actually makes one thing human. See what he mentioned beneath:

Samuel Blenkin: I imply even in our universe Weyland-Yutani is sort of a hulking behemoth of an organization, that is how we think about it. They’ve a lot energy and a lot management, however they’re virtually swollen. They’re too massive, they have an excessive amount of affect, and we’re a 10-year-old firm. I really feel like I am really at a gathering, a shareholder assembly. ‘Pay attention, we’re a 10-year-old firm. We transfer quick!’ Boy Kavalier sees himself because the leading edge and clearly in our collection, the know-how that he is created, these hybrids, he sees them as the final word factor that may change humanity’s course eternally and can lead in the end to us transcending our human our bodies and shifting into artificial our bodies eternally. That is in the end the intention. And I suppose the query for my character and one of many questions on the coronary heart of the collection is, what’s human sufficient? As a result of the reply to that query relies on whether or not what he is made is one thing that he can promote to all people and that everyone will purchase, or whether or not it is one thing that no one is ever going to need to contact. It is that query of what’s human sufficient? What counts as being human?

What Blenkin’s Assertion Means For The Prodigy Company In Alien: Earth

As revealed in trailers for the collection, the Prodigy Company makes a speciality of creating artificial our bodies for people. The protagonist on the forged of Alien: Earth, Wendy, is one in all these hybrids, the primary ever produced by the corporate. This tech is fully new to the franchise, and one thing that not even Weyland-Yutani has been in a position to convey to the desk.

Primarily based on out there opinions for Alien: Earth up to now, it looks like Prodigy might be including some nuance to the franchise, which may embrace some new parts which have but to be showcased within the trailers. Blenkin’s assertion emphasizes how the corporate is making an attempt to be distinct from its greater competitors, and the way it ties into the present’s core themes.

Provided that the corporate shouldn’t be talked about wherever else on the Alien timeline, it is unclear what its destiny might be when the present involves a detailed. Nonetheless, their know-how is one thing extremely groundbreaking, particularly for one thing that takes place earlier than the primary film. It raises questions on humanity whereas additionally providing a manner for the preservation of individuals.
